Setting up parts searches embedded into your website if not hosted by ISoft.

The search is placed within an iframe.

The iframe is reactive so it is able to scale to widths above 300px. For most uses they should set the height to something around 800px.

The example below will open the search to all parts you have available.

ex. <iframe src ="http://iframe_ex.heavytruckparts.net" width="100%" height="800px" border="0"></iframe>


Replace the http://iframe_ex.heavytruckparts.net above with the links and options that you want below on the parts search page.
